A Graduate Certificate in Fishery Stock Assessment Models and Methods equips students with the advanced quantitative skills needed for sustainable fisheries management. The program focuses on developing expertise in population dynamics, statistical modeling, and data analysis relevant to fisheries science.
Learning outcomes typically include proficiency in applying various stock assessment models, such as surplus production models and age-structured models, to real-world fishery data. Students will also master techniques for data collection, analysis, and interpretation, crucial for informing fisheries management decisions. This includes experience with software packages commonly used in the field.
The duration of the certificate program varies depending on the institution, but generally ranges from a few months to one year of part-time or full-time study. The program's intensive curriculum allows for quick acquisition of specialized skills within a focused timeframe.
